This means the named range can be accessed by any worksheet in your Excel file. Make sure you hit the ENTER key after you have finished typing the name to confirm the creation of the Named Range.Īs a side note, any Named Range created with the Name Box has a Workbook scope. ![]() You name cannot have any spaces in it, so if you need to separate words you can either capitalize the beginning of each new word or use an underscore (). Here are a list of common names I use on a regular basis: ReportDate Year Month FcstID TaxRate RawData Creating Unique Names On The Fly It is super easy to create a Named Range.Īll you have to do is highlight the cell(s) you want to reference and give it a name in the Name Box. I use named ranges to organize my variables that either are changed infrequently (ie Month or Year) or something that will be static for a good amount of time (ie inflation rate). ![]() How Do I Use Named Ranges As a financial analyst, I play around with a bunch of rates.Įxamples could be anything from a tax rate to an estimated inflation rate.
